Bol The various chapters demonstrate Bourdieu's thinking for higher education policy analysis, maps neoliberal issues in higher education management, highlights internal and external environmental problems in Indonesian higher education, and showcases a series of comprehensive challenges and criticisms of Indonesia's higher education policy. This book contributes to the advancement of knowledge regarding higher education policy and management, not only in Indonesia, but in countries that have economic inequality and are forced to operationalize neoliberal-oriented education, using the analytical approach of Bourdieu's thought. The various chapters demonstrate Bourdieu's thinking for higher education policy analysis, maps neoliberal issues in higher education management, highlights internal and external environmental problems in Indonesian higher education, and showcases a series of comprehensive challenges and criticisms of Indonesia's higher education policy. This book serves as a useful reference for public policy students with an interest in the conceptualization of higher education policy and for higher education leaders to formulate strategic policies and develop higher education policies that are more just and democratic.
